User Controls

ASP.NET의 캐시된 사용자 컨트롤에서 동적 링크 구현 방법

서론: 캐시된 사용자 컨트롤에서 동적 링크의 도전 과제 웹 개발 세계, 특히 ASP.NET을 사용한 개발에서 사용자 컨트롤을 캐싱하면 정적 콘텐츠를 기반으로 서버 왕복을 자주 할 필요 없이 성능을 극적으로 향상시킬 수 있습니다. 그러나 사용자 컨트롤이 현재 페이지에 따라 변경되는 링크와 같은 동적 콘텐츠를 필요로 할 경우, 캐싱의 간단함을 도전받는 난관에 ...

ASP.NET 사용자 컨트롤을 효율적으로 캐시하는 방법

ASP.NET 사용자 컨트롤 캐싱: 포괄적인 가이드 캐싱은 웹 애플리케이션의 성능을 크게 향상시킬 수 있는 강력한 기술입니다. ASP.NET 애플리케이션이 있는 경우, 전체 페이지 대신 사용자 컨트롤을 캐시하는 것에 대해 들어본 적이 있을 것입니다. 이는 특히 헤더 및 푸터와 같은 정적 콘텐츠를 표시하는 컨트롤에 유용합니다. ...

ASP.NET MVC에서 사용자 컨트롤 구현에 대한 궁극적인 가이드

ASP.NET MVC에서 사용자 컨트롤 구현에 대한 궁극적인 가이드 개발자들이 전통적인 ASP.NET 2.0 Web Forms에서 보다 현대적인 ASP.NET MVC 프레임워크로 전환하면서 여러 가지 질문이 생깁니다. 가장 일반적인 질문 중 하나는 어떻게 새로운 환경에서 사용자 컨트롤을 효과적으로 구현할 수 있는가입니다. 기존의 .ASCX 컨트롤이 많고 디 ...

C#에서 페이지의 전체 URL을 쉽게 가져오는 방법

C#에서 페이지의 전체 URL을 쉽게 가져오는 방법 C#과 ASP.NET을 사용하고 있다면, 사용자 컨트롤 내에서 웹 페이지의 전체 URL을 가져와야 할 필요가 있을 것입니다. 이 요구는 동적으로 링크를 생성하거나 리다이렉트를 처리하거나 현재 페이지의 주소에 의존하는 기능을 수행할 때 흔하게 발생합니다. 스킴, 호스트, 경로와 같은 다양한 구성 요소를 연결 ...

ASP.NET 사용자 정의 컨트롤 - 컴포지트에 대한 이해: UserControls, 사용자 정의 컴포지트 및 렌더링된 컨트롤

ASP.NET 사용자 정의 컨트롤 - 컴포지트 이해하기 웹 개발, 특히 ASP.NET의 세계에서는 기능적이면서도 미적으로 만족스러운 사용자 인터페이스를 만드는 것이 고유한 도전을 제기할 수 있습니다. 이러한 도전 중 하나는 개발자가 사용자 정의 컨트롤을 구현하려고 할 때 발생합니다. 이 블로그 포스트는 사용자 정의 컨트롤의 복잡성을 깊이 있게 탐구하며, 컴 ...

.Net 사용자 제어 디자인 문제 해결: ListView 변경 사항 유지하기

.Net 사용자 제어로 디자인 문제 수정하기 .NET에서 사용자 제어(UserControl)를 만드는 것은 특히 ListView와 같은 컴포넌트를 통합할 때 흥미로운 작업이 될 수 있습니다. 하지만 일부 개발자들은 디자인 수정이 컴파일 후 사라지는 불만을 겪습니다. 사용자 제어 내에서 ListView를 사용자 지정하려고 할 때 이러한 문제에 직면했다면, 당 ...

ASP.NET 사용자 컨트롤에서 처리되지 않은 예외를 효과적으로 처리하는 방법

ASP.NET 사용자 컨트롤에서 처리되지 않은 예외 포착하기 ASP.NET 사용자 컨트롤 작업을 수행할 때 개발자가 직면하는 공통적인 문제 중 하나는 렌더링 중 처리되지 않은 예외를 관리하는 것입니다. 이는 깨진 사용자 인터페이스나 방해받은 사용자 경험과 같은 바람직하지 않은 결과로 이어질 수 있습니다. 이 게시물에서는 안전 로딩 기술을 사용하여 이러한 예 ...

ASP.NET 사용자 컨트롤의 DefaultEvent 명확히 하기

ASP.NET 사용자 컨트롤의 DefaultEvent 이해하기 ASP.NET에서 사용자 컨트롤을 개발할 때, 개발자들은 자주 맞닥뜨리는 특정한 도전이 있습니다: 사용자 컨트롤의 DefaultEvent를 어떻게 설정할 것인가 하는 것입니다. 이는 워크플로우를 간소화하고, 더블 클릭 동작을 통해 필요한 이벤트 핸들러를 자동으로 생성하고자 할 때 특히 중요합니 ...

Windows Mobile에서 C# UserControls의 디자이너 속성 사용자 정의 방법

Windows Mobile의 C# UserControls를 위한 디자이너 속성 사용자 정의 C#로 응용 프로그램을 개발할 때 특히 Windows Mobile을 위해 UserControls의 디자이너 속성 창에서 속성의 가시성 및 분류와 관련된 일반적인 문제를 만날 수 있습니다. 이는 기본 카테고리가 종종 속성을 “기타(Misc)” 아래 ...

.NET 인터페이스 이해하기: 사용자 제어 설계를 위한 모범 사례

.NET 인터페이스 이해하기: 사용자 제어 설계를 위한 모범 사례 소프트웨어 개발 분야, 특히 .NET을 사용할 때 개발자들은 종종 디자인 패턴 및 모범 사례와 관련된 딜레마에 직면하게 됩니다. 이러한 논의 중 하나는 사용자 제어 설계에 관한 것입니다: 속성을 직접 채워야 할까요, 아니면 정보를 제어로 로드하기 위해 매개변수화된 하위 프로시저를 사용해야 할 ...

윈폼 사용자 컨트롤에서의 효과적인 전역 예외 처리

윈폼 사용자 컨트롤에서 전역 예외 처리 마스터하기 애플리케이션을 개발할 때 예외 처리는 간과할 수 없는 중요한 측면입니다. Windows Forms 애플리케이션, 특히 사용자 컨트롤을 사용할 때는 견고한 전역 예외 처리 메커니즘이 처리되지 않은 예외를 우아하게 잡을 수 있도록 보장합니다. 이는 사용자 경험을 향상시킬 뿐만 아니라 애플리케이션을 디버깅하고 유 ...